Category: Integrated Circuit (IC)
Use: Non-volatile memory storage
Characteristics: - Low power consumption - High reliability - Small form factor - Wide operating voltage range
Package: 8-pin SOIC (Small Outline Integrated Circuit)
Essence: The CAT24C04YI-GT3JN is a 4K-bit serial EEPROM (Electrically Erasable Programmable Read-Only Memory) IC.
Packaging/Quantity: Available in tape and reel packaging, with 2500 units per reel.

Advantages: - Small form factor allows for space-efficient designs. - Wide operating voltage range enables compatibility with various systems. - High endurance write cycles ensure reliable data storage. - Data retention of 100 years ensures long-term data integrity.
Disadvantages: - Limited memory size (4K bits) may not be sufficient for certain applications. - Requires an external I2C bus for communication.
The CAT24C04YI-GT3JN is based on EEPROM technology, which allows for electrically erasing and reprogramming of data. It utilizes an I2C interface to communicate with a microcontroller or other devices. The memory cells within the IC store data in a non-volatile manner, meaning the data remains intact even when power is disconnected. The IC can be written to and read from using the serial data input/output (SDA) and serial clock input (SCL) pins.

Q: What is CAT24C04YI-GT3JN? A: CAT24C04YI-GT3JN is a serial EEPROM (Electrically Erasable Programmable Read-Only Memory) chip manufactured by ON Semiconductor.
Q: What is the capacity of CAT24C04YI-GT3JN? A: CAT24C04YI-GT3JN has a capacity of 4 kilobits, which is equivalent to 512 bytes or 4096 bits.
Q: What is the operating voltage range for CAT24C04YI-GT3JN? A: The operating voltage range for CAT24C04YI-GT3JN is typically between 1.7V and 5.5V.
Q: How is CAT24C04YI-GT3JN connected to a microcontroller or other devices? A: CAT24C04YI-GT3JN uses a standard I2C (Inter-Integrated Circuit) interface for communication with microcontrollers or other devices.
Q: Can CAT24C04YI-GT3JN be used for storing program code or firmware? A: Yes, CAT24C04YI-GT3JN can be used for storing small program code or firmware, but it has limited capacity compared to larger memory options.
Q: What is the maximum data transfer speed of CAT24C04YI-GT3JN? A: CAT24C04YI-GT3JN supports a maximum data transfer speed of up to 400 kilobits per second (Kbps).
Q: Is CAT24C04YI-GT3JN suitable for applications requiring frequent data writes? A: Yes, CAT24C04YI-GT3JN is designed for frequent data writes and can handle up to 1 million write cycles.
